Effortless Pixie Cuts for Busy Women
A pixie cut is one of the best hairstyling options for women who are short on time and busy. With its classic and timeless nature, one can quickly opt for a pixie cut as it requires little maintenance. The following are some of the popular variations of pixie cut that one should consider:
1. Classic Pixie Cut: The classic pixie cut is a lengthier version of the traditional buzz cut while still maintaining its essence. The hair on the sides and back is cut very short, while the hair on top is cut slightly longer than the rest. Styling of the hair is way easier and such hairstyle is less of a hassle to maintain.
- Length: On average, this type of haircut ranges between 1-4 inches, with most cuts being around two inches.
- Styling: Applying a small amount of wax or pomade and a comb will achieve a bedhead look for this type of pixie cut.
- Maintenance: The shape-defining style can be maintained by trimming every four to six weeks.
2. Textured Pixie Cut: The textured pixie cut is a great choice for those with thinner hair. The hairstyle has more movement and volume while making it look bushy enough to make a statement. As versatile as this hairstyle, it can be worn numerous times.
- Length: The sides and back hair is cut short while the top portion is cut a little longer at around 2 to 3 inches.
- Styling: Mousse or volumizing spray is recommended on wet hair, followed by a dry using the fingers or a round brush, and lifting it. Finish off the look with a light-hold hairspray.
- Maintenance: Regular trims are crucial, as they preserve the hair’s intended shape and prevent it from growing out too much and becoming unmanageable.
3. Side-Swept Pixie Cut: The side-swept pixie cut exudes a certain grace and charm lacking in the traditional pixie. Basically, it has longer bangs or fringe and is styled to one side.
- Length: The back and sides of the scalp are short while the bangs remain long, covering the eyebrow even longer.
- Styling: For volumizing and smoothness, round brushing the damp hair after applying a styling cream or serum, then blow-drying the hair will do the work. After that, the bangs can be flat-ironed and swept to one side for an elegant finish, if desired.
- Maintenance: It is very important to have steady trims that will keep the bangs to the desired length and the hairstyle’s shape intact.
These easy-to-manage pixie cuts are perfect for busy women because they are stylish, cut, and pretty easy to work with. Pick a style from the various pixie cuts to suit your face shape, hair type, and hair texture and enjoy a chic hairstyle while also saving a lot of time.

Using the Right Products for Textured Short Hair
When it comes to maintaining textured short hair, choosing the right products is essential to enhance its natural beauty and keep it healthy. Here are some key considerations to keep in mind:
- Moisturizing Shampoos and Conditioners: Look for sulfate-free shampoos and conditioners specially formulated for textured hair. These products help retain moisture, prevent dryness, and minimize frizz.
- Leave-In Conditioners: Leave-in conditioners are crucial for providing extra moisture and nourishment to your short hair. Opt for lightweight, non-greasy formulas that won’t weigh down your hair.
- Curl-Enhancing Creams and Gels: To define and enhance your natural curls or waves, consider using curl-enhancing creams or gels. These products help add structure, reduce frizz, and provide long-lasting hold.
- Heat Protectant Sprays: If you use heat styling tools like flat irons or curling wands, it’s important to protect your hair from heat damage. Apply a heat protectant spray before styling to minimize potential harm to your hair.
Remember, every individual’s hair is unique, so it may take some experimentation to find the products that work best for your specific hair texture and needs. Consult with your stylist or conduct research to identify suitable products that will help you achieve the desired results. By using the right products that address the specific needs of your textured short hair, you can maintain its health, enhance its natural beauty, and embrace your unique style.
Styling Tips for Short Hair with Bangs or Fringe
When it comes to styling short hair with bangs or fringe, attention to detail and precision are key. Here are some expert tips to help you achieve the perfect look:
- Choose the Right Bangs: The type of bangs or fringe you choose can greatly impact your overall hairstyle. Consider factors such as your face shape, hair texture, and personal style when deciding on the length and shape of your bangs.
- Blow-dry with a Round Brush: To create volume and shape, use a round brush while blow-drying your bangs. Start at the roots and gently roll the brush inward, directing the airflow downward. This helps to smooth out any kinks and give your bangs a polished finish.
- Use Styling Products: Apply a small amount of styling product, such as a lightweight mousse or styling cream, to your bangs before blow-drying. This helps to control frizz, add definition, and provide hold throughout the day.
- Try Different Styling Techniques: Experiment with different styling techniques to achieve a variety of looks. Use a flat iron to straighten your bangs for a sleek and sophisticated style, or use a small curling iron to add soft waves or curls for a playful and romantic look.
- Refresh with Dry Shampoo: To keep your bangs looking fresh in between washes, use a dry shampoo to absorb excess oil and add texture. This will help to extend the time between washes and keep your bangs looking voluminous and full.
Remember, practice makes perfect when it comes to styling short hair with bangs or fringe. Don’t be afraid to try new techniques and experiment with different products to find what works best for your hair type and desired style.
